The Undead King of the Palace of Darkness (WN)

Chapter 15: The Bargain



The courtyard of the Lord’s mansion. The moon shone peacefully in the night sky.

I spin around and use the centrifugal force to swing my machete. The Skeleton Knight who is on alert, poised for defense, uses inhuman strength to ward off the blow, by retreating a few steps back and cleverly maneuvering the sword it held in both hands.

I could sense the weight of training and experience that went behind that single move.

The quality of a Skeleton largely depends on the principal abilities of the skeleton used in its creation. Because one’s experience is ingrained into the body.

If an accomplished soldier’s skeleton is used, then a Skeleton with adequate combat abilities can be created. On the other hand, if a skeleton with no combat experience, in other words, a civilian’s skeleton is used, there will be a huge difference between the two even though they are both the same class of undead. And this may be a cock-and-bull story, but the undead created from the remains of an ancient mythical hero is purported to have slaughtered even a dragon.

Skeleton and fleshman are both one of the lowest classes of the undead.

The undead can be created from four types of sources.

Namely, a Skeleton that is born from the skeleton of a living being. A Fleshman that is born from the corpse. A Wraith that is born from the soul. A Zombie that is born from the decomposed remains, as a result of necromancy.

Each has their own traits, but there are no distinctive differences between them. I, who evolved into a ghoul from a fleshman, am better than the Skeleton (it is clad in armor and using a knight’s sword, but it is a skeleton underneath all that), in terms of ability.
